Short Byte: Camille Fournier - Managing a product focused engineering org Camille Fournier is perhaps best known for her amazing book “the managers path” - a guide for tech leaders navigating growth and change. But she also has a degree from Carnegie Mellon, was a VP at Goldman Sachs, and then was the CTO at Rent The Runway before eventually returning to the finance world as Head of Platform Engineering at Two Sigma.
